MEET THE FOUNDER
SARAH ELISIO
Founder & Instructor
Movement has always been my outlet. From stepping into a dance studio at four years old to competing for over 15 years, movement became where I felt most grounded, focused, and connected. Dance taught me discipline, presence, and the power of community—values that carried me across international stages in Germany and Prague and later to the Ryerson Competitive Dance Team.
In 2020, I discovered strength training and fell in love with the structure, progression, and confidence it builds, leading me to complete my Personal Training certification through CanFitPro. Soon after, Pilates and barre became essential to my practice, allowing me to blend my background in dance with intentional, strength-based movement.
I later completed my training in STOTT Reformer Pilates and Barre, and from that journey, SIO ATHLETIC STUDIOS was born. SIO is a reflection of everything I value in movement: intention, consistency, and community. My goal is to create a space where people can move with confidence, feel supported, and build strength in a way that’s sustainable and empowering—no matter where they’re starting from.
Let’s move together.
— Sarah
